Walkthrough
- 1Scan Fragments: Most Fragments can be scanned using the Codex or Synthesis Scanner. This unlocks artwork and lore entries in the Codex under the 'Universe' tab.
- 2Audio Lore: Each scanned image has a hidden point that, when hovered over with the cursor, unlocks a short audio transmission with additional lore. White noise serves as an audio clue to its location.
- 3Interact Fragments: Some Fragments do not require scanning and can be acquired by interacting with them (default key 'X').
- 4Fragment Types: Fragments are categorized by their origin and lore focus, including Cephalon, Fish, Glass, Ghoul, Revenant, Solaris United, Partnership, The Tenets, Duviri, Albrecht, and Isleweaver.
- 5Cephalon Fragments: These appear as hovering blue data blocks, usually found in mission rooms. They unlock lore about the Origin System's Factions, Characters, and Planets, and reveal Ordis' Past. They cannot be found in Defense, Interception, or Archwing missions.
- 6Fragment Locations: Fragments are found on most planets, moons, and locations in the Origin System, including the Void and Deimos, with 2-3 unlockable fragments per location.
- 7Scanning Requirements: Each fragment requires a specific number of scans to unlock, ranging from 3 to 7.
- 8Lore Content: The lore unlocked by Fragments covers various aspects of the Warframe universe, from planetary descriptions and faction histories to character backstories and the nature of Cephalons.
Tips
- Use loot radar mods to help locate Cephalon Fragments on your mini-map as blue quadruple diamonds.
- Listen for the white noise to find the hidden audio lore points on scanned images.
- Fragments are released in chronological order of their introduction into the game.
